CGI::Wiki::Plugin::Locator::UKA CGI::Wiki plugin to manage UK location data | |
Download |
CGI::Wiki::Plugin::Locator::UK Ranking & Summary
Advertisement
- License:
- Perl Artistic License
- Price:
- FREE
- Publisher Name:
- Kake L Pugh
- Publisher web site:
- http://search.cpan.org/~kake/
CGI::Wiki::Plugin::Locator::UK Tags
CGI::Wiki::Plugin::Locator::UK Description
A CGI::Wiki plugin to manage UK location data CGI::Wiki::Plugin::Locator::UKCGI is a Perl module that offers access to and calculations using British National Grid location metadata supplied to a CGI::Wiki wiki when writing a node. (For converting between British National Grid co-ordinates and latitude/longitude, you may wish to look at Geography::NationalGrid.)SYNOPSIS use CGI::Wiki; use CGI::Wiki::Plugin::Locator::UK; my $wiki = CGI::Wiki->new( ... ); my $locator = CGI::Wiki::Plugin::Locator::UK->new; $wiki->register_plugin( plugin => $locator ); $wiki->write_node( "Jerusalem Tavern", "A good pub", $checksum, { os_x => 531674, os_y => 181950 } ); # Just retrieve the co-ordinates. my ( $x, $y ) = $locator->coordinates( node => "Jerusalem Tavern" ); # Find the straight-line distance between two nodes, in kilometres. my $distance = $locator->distance( from_node => "Jerusalem Tavern", to_node => "Calthorpe Arms" ); # Find all the things within 200 metres of a given place. my @others = $locator->find_within_distance( node => "Albion", metres => 200 ); Requirements: · Perl
CGI::Wiki::Plugin::Locator::UK Related Software